Understanding Construction Defects: The Hidden Threat to Project Success

Construction defects represent a significant challenge in general contracting, often resulting in costly rework, delayed timelines, and diminished client trust. These issues can stem from design discrepancies, material failures, or poor workmanship, making early detection and prevention critical for project viability.

Core Strategies for Defect Prevention in General Contracting

Integrating defect prevention into every phase of a project is essential for general contractors aiming to deliver superior results. Proactive measures not only reduce the risk of post-construction litigation but also enhance reputation and client satisfaction.

  • Implement rigorous quality control protocols at every project milestone
  • Utilize detailed checklists for critical construction activities
  • Conduct regular interdisciplinary coordination meetings to resolve design ambiguities
  • Adopt advanced material testing procedures before installation
  • Leverage third-party inspections for unbiased quality assessments
Preventing defects is far less costly than correcting them after project completion.

The Role of Technology in Defect Detection and Mitigation

Modern technology has revolutionized defect prevention. From digital inspection tools to real-time project management platforms, contractors can now identify potential issues before they escalate, ensuring a higher standard of quality and compliance.

TechnologyDefect Prevention Benefit
Thermal ImagingDetects moisture intrusion and insulation gaps
Mobile Inspection AppsStreamlines on-site reporting and corrective actions
Laser ScanningEnsures dimensional accuracy and as-built verification
Cloud-Based CollaborationEnhances document control and version tracking

Measuring Success: Key Metrics for Defect Prevention Initiatives

Tracking the effectiveness of defect prevention strategies is vital for continuous improvement. By monitoring specific metrics, contractors can pinpoint recurring issues and adjust processes to mitigate future risks.

MetricPurpose
Rework RateTracks frequency and cost of corrective work
Inspection Pass RateMeasures compliance with quality benchmarks
Client CallbacksIndicates post-handover defect frequency
Warranty ClaimsHighlights long-term construction quality
